A refreshed and enhanced version of Space Hulk, a turn-based strategy game created by Full Control, which builds upon a popular board game experience. The game offers 3 campaigns comprising over 100 missions, during which the players get to lead Space Marine Terminators to battle against Tyranid Genestealers. When compared to the original installment, Space Hulk: Ascension features a much more elaborate array of options, allowing the players to command their squad. Moreover, each Terminator at the player’s command can be customized. They also gain experience points, which in turn can be used to develop their skills and attributes. To top it all off, Space Hulk: Ascension delivers us new Genestealer variations, along with previously unavailable weaponry. An original turn-based strategy created by Auroch Digital. Blood Red States is an adaptation of a board game known as Dark Future and released in 1988 by Games Workshop. The players are taken to a post-apocalyptic world destroyed as a result of a global cataclysm. Well-armed squads known as Sanctioned Ops serve the role of law enforcement now, patrolling the ruined roads and highways. Assuming the roles of the squads' leaders, the players take part in spectacular chases, going after various mobsters and gang members. The experience was based on an unusual pattern, as the gameplay is turn-based and the sides give orders to their units at the same time; afterwards, they observe several seconds of real-time action, when their orders are being executed. The key to success here is not only to react to the opponent's actions, but also to predict their moves and initiate risky maneuvers that can tip the balance in favor of the player's victory.

A mobile version of the popular browser game, Card Hunter, developed by Blue Manchu and DropForge Games. The action of Loot & Legends is set in a typical fantasy land and the gameplay boils down to exploring dungeons and fighting encountered monsters. The game is divided into modules, each having a completely different, self-encompassing story. Mechanics-wise, the production combines a turn-based strategy game with elements borrowed from CCGs and board games, while the gameplay rules were designed by Richard Garfield, the creator of the popular Magic: The Gathering collectible card game. Battles are fought in turns on maps covered with a grid. While fighting, we command a several-member party of adventurers and perform every action by playing cards drawn from the deck. The game is designed to resemble tabletop role-playing games which are played with the use of figurines and paper maps.

A board game taking place in Japan during the feudal period and the debut production of Russian developer Red Unit Studios. Warbands: Bushido is a board game enabling us to assume the role of one of the daimyo ruling provinces of Japan during the Sengoku Period. The quest to gain power and influence will involve battles of large military forces, as well as espionage and convert assassinations. Aside from the major players, the land is roamed by numerous smaller parties such as samurai, ronin, ninja clans, pirates, or mercenaries. The action is seen from an isometric perspective, while the map is divided into hexagonal fields. The combat is turn-based – each side throws dice to deal damage and perform special actions. Moreover, we can utilize action cards, offering bonuses such as additional critical chance or more action points. Morale is also an important factor, increasing the effectiveness of our units.

A match-3 logic puzzle game and an adaptation of a board game of the same name. The production was developed by Clangore. The game takes place in the Horribilorum Sorcery Academy, and your task is to brew increasingly complicated potions. To succeed, you have to follow the instructions and choose the right ingredients. When you clear one of them, just like in any other match-3 game, the ones above them fall down, often diametrically changing the whole board. If two components of the same kind touch, they explode. Another obstacle is the limited capacity of the ingredients container. Potion Explosion features a single player mode, in which you play against the AI, and a multiplayer mode, in which you compete with other players. There is also an online ranking to display you accomplishments.

A tactical turn-based strategy game set during World War II; it was developed by Cat Rabbit studio, supported by the Slitherine company. Interestingly, the game is a virtual adaptation of a popular board game which came out in 2014. The game is set just after the D-Day, when the Allies landed in Normandy. Three playable armies are at the player's disposal - the Americans, the British and the Germans. Each of the entities involved was given its own in-game story campaign focusing on the titular heroes. Gameplay is turn-based and each of the armies has its own set of unique units, equipment and special abilities in the form of cards one can make use of. The game offers a solo experience and a multiplayer mode, but also a functional editor, allowing the player to create their own maps and armies. Heroes of Normandie comes with relatively simplistic visuals and a hilarious atmosphere.

Wartile is an RTS with elements of card and board games. The game takes place in a dark fantasy world inspired by the Norse mythology. We control a party of vikings on a raid. Gameplay focuses on real-time battles between groups of warriors. Each of them has their own strengths and weaknesses, and the key to victory lies in taking advantage of them. Another important gameplay element is the deck of cards built by the players. Those cards will not only power up our warriors, but also activate both offensive and defensive actions. Cards also play an important role in exploration. Battles take place on three-dimensional maps that are divided into hexagonal tiles, and lay of the land, which is an important tactical element that should be taken under consideration when we are preparing our strategy. As a result, Wartile brings to mind a turn-based strategy that somehow takes place in real-time. Along with the story driven campaign Wartile offers a multiplayer mode. The game uses Unreal Engine 4.

A video game adaptation of a board game of the same title, set in the universe of the popular MMORPGs Wakfu and Dofus. Just like its two predecessors it was developed by the French company Ankama. The title expands on the ideas known from the original, while combining elements of a board game, tactical turn-based strategy, and RPG. Gameplay focuses on spectacular duels of the most famous warriors from both of the aforementioned games. Unlike other typical board games Krosmaster Arena lets you command a party of champions, whom you recruit gradually as you play. Each one of them has their own characteristic skills, hence the key to success lies not only in proper tactics, but also smart use of the characters, so that they complement one another on the battlefield. Gameplay is enriched by a wide selection of special cards that represent spells and items – multiplying the available tactical options even further.

A turn-based strategy game set during the Napoleonic Wars, developed by Glenn Drover, a renowned board games designer. We assume the role of the famous French emperor, who faces a coalition of over a dozen European countries led by the British, in six varied scenarios that take place between 1800 and 1813. The gameplay mechanics of Victory and Glory: Napoleon combine classic strategy, card, and board game elements. It focuses on tactical land and naval battles with the use of actual units and their most famous commanders. The result of each battle is dependent not only on the parameters of the participating units but also on random factors. The special event cards, which are drawn before we start playing and then at every subsequent turn, are an important modifier. The title allows us to compete only against a computer-controlled opponent.

Culdcept Revolt is a turn-based RPG developed by Omiya Soft, which uses elements of card and board games and was released as part of celebration of the 20th anniversary of the Culdcept series. The game takes us to a fantasy world where we play as a boy named Allen. He's a recruit in the Rebel Army that fights to put an end to the tyrannical rule of Count Kraniss. As we play, we take part in turn-based battles that take place on grid-covered maps. Our goal in each fight is to get as much points as possible. They are given to us for taking control over new sectors of the map. A throw of dice decides how far we can move during our turn. If we encounter an enemy while making our move, a battle begins, during which we use monster and spell cards. We learn the game's story through visual novel-like cut-scenes. Culdcept Revolt offers a local and online multiplayer for up to four players.
